There are 3 repositories under proc-macro topic.
A library for to allow multiple return types by automatically generated enum.
A procedural macro for auto logging output of functions
Async stream for Rust and the futures crate.
Finite state machine framework for Rust with readable specifications
A procedure macro to unify SYNC and ASYNC implementation for downstream application/crates
Generate Yew components from React components via Typescript type definitions
Proc macro attributes for Bastion runtime.
A proc macro for real async traits, using nightly-only existential types and generic associated types to work around the need for type erasure
A Rust crate to expressively declare bitfield-like structs
Lombok port for Rust
Parsing and inspecting Rust literals (particularly useful for proc macros)
A collection of Rust proc macros that allow the exporting and importing of TokenStream2s of items in foreign contexts and files
cargo subcommand for building proc-macro crates with web assembly
A procedural macro helper for easily writing custom derives for enums.
Autogenerated Bytewise SIMD-Optimized Look-Up Tables
Proc-macro based einsum implementation for rust-ndarray
A cursed macro that compiles and executes Rust and spits the output directly into your Rust code
A lightweight attribute for easy generation of const functions with conditional compilations.
Proc macro derive to generate structs from enum variants.
Traits and functions to make writing proc macros more ergonomic.
Allows for dynamic compile-time embedding of existing tests and examples in your Rust doc comments and markdown files